Step 3: Make the Dressing
- Now, let’s whip up that balsamic dressing.
- In a mixing bowl, combine the maple syrup and Dijon mustard.
- Gradually whisk in the olive oil until you achieve an emulsion—a consistent, blended dressing.
- Add the lime juice for that necessary zing.
- Sprinkle in the black sea salt, oregano, and the aged balsamic vinegar to build depth and flavor.
- Finally, add the smoked paprika, onion flakes, and garlic granules. Stir well.
Step 4: Toss the Salad
- Pour the dressing over your greens and veggies. Use tongs to gently mix everything together, ensuring an even coating.
Step 5: Serve and Enjoy!
- Once tossed, serve immediately for the freshest taste.
Notes
- Adjust the Sweetness: If you prefer a sweeter dressing, feel free to increase the maple syrup based on your tastes.
- Fresh Ingredients: Always opt for fresh herbs when possible. They elevate flavors beyond dried options.
- Make Ahead: The dressing can be made a day in advance. Just keep it in the fridge, and shake before serving.
- Add Protein: For a more substantial meal, consider adding grilled chicken, chickpeas, or tofu.
- Mind the Consistency: If the dressing is too thick, a splash of water can help thin it out.
